摘要
In this paper, using zero-crossing method, the neutron-gamma discrimination has been discussed to estimate the contribution of light transport on the timing characteristics of scintillation detectors. Both experimental and simulation verifications for the influence of lightguide length on the neutron-gamma discrimination quality of a 2 x 2 in. NE213 scintillator have been presented.
